Darius Bačinskas is a scholar working on Civil and Structural Engineering, Building and Construction and Mechanical Engineering. According to data from OpenAlex, Darius Bačinskas has authored 53 papers receiving a total of 793 indexed citations (citations by other indexed papers that have themselves been cited), including 51 papers in Civil and Structural Engineering, 38 papers in Building and Construction and 8 papers in Mechanical Engineering. Recurrent topics in Darius Bačinskas's work include Structural Behavior of Reinforced Concrete (32 papers), Structural Load-Bearing Analysis (21 papers) and Innovative concrete reinforcement materials (20 papers). Darius Bačinskas is often cited by papers focused on Structural Behavior of Reinforced Concrete (32 papers), Structural Load-Bearing Analysis (21 papers) and Innovative concrete reinforcement materials (20 papers). Darius Bačinskas collaborates with scholars based in Lithuania, Taiwan and Slovakia. Darius Bačinskas's co-authors include Gintaris Kaklauskas, Viktor Gribniak, Povilas Vainiūnas, Nauman Ijaz, Muhammad Faisal Junaid, Miroslav Čekon, Zia ur Rehman, Wajahat Sammer Ansari, Jakub Čurpek and Igor Medveď and has published in prestigious journals such as SHILAP Revista de lepidopterología, Construction and Building Materials and Sustainability.
